Soap Bubble Structures by Kym Cox. Bubbles optimise space and minimise their surface area for a given volume of air. This phenomenon makes them a useful tool in many areas of research, in particular, materials science and ‘packing’ – how things fit together. Bubble walls drain under gravity, thin at the top, thick at the bottom, which interferes with travelling lightwaves to create bands of colour. Black spots show the wall is too thin for interference colours, indicating the bubble is about to burst. (Photo by Kym Cox/2019 Science Photographer of the Year/RPS)

A view of the construction site of the Chateau de Guedelon near Treigny in the Burgundy region of France, September 13, 2016. Blacksmiths, stonemasons and quarry men are hard at work in a Burgundy forest building a 13th-century-style castle using the most basic tools and materials, replicating the methods used hundreds of years ago to better understand them. Forgoing all modern technology, workers use hammers to break stones and forge iron, operate wooden wheels to hoist their materials up to where they are needed, and rely on a quarry for stone, clay and sand as they build up a castle from scratch. Construction on Guedelon Castle in central France began in 1997 after an archaeological survey revealed a medieval fortress hidden inside the walls of nearby Chateau de Saint-Fargeau. Those behind the project hope to answer questions about medieval construction and provide lessons on sustainable building. (Photo by Jacky Naegelen/Reuters)

Anatomical Toys By Jason Freeny

New York based artist Jason Freeny slices open pop-culture characters to reveal their insides. He takes vinyl toys of annimated icons such as Stewie Griffin, Nemo and Mario, and stuffs them with Sculpey modelling clay. He then carves out bones aqnd organs using dental tools.

Parallel Worlds By Karezoid Michal Karcz

Karezoid Michal Karcz is a photographer from Warsaw, Poland. He first started with painting, which helped him to develop a vision that was hard to create with other visual techniques. Then in early 90s discovered photography. His early fascinations of painting and photography have been combined into one piece, with the use of digital tools. Digital photography gave him the opportunity to generate unique realities that were impossible to be created with an ordinary dark room techniques.

The Unforbidden Cyclist By Thomas Yang

Image patterning has existed for hundreds of years; however, before Thomas Yang no one has ever thought of putting paint on the bicycle wheels and using it as a patterning tool to create very interesting-looking pictures. Being an avid cyclist and an artist, Thomas Yang has decided to combine the two, creating the 100copies. The name of this project not only alludes to the fact that only one hundred copies of those pictures were going to be made, but also to the fact that the pictures themselves consist of hundreds of repeating shapes. And even though the project is called 100copies, no two pictures are alike due to the nature of their creation, making them truly unique. (Photo by Thomas Yang)

The NASA Extreme Environment Mission Operations (NEEMO) 21 mission began on July 21 as an international crew of aquanauts splashed down to the undersea Aquarius Reef Base, located 62 feet below the surface of the Atlantic Ocean in the Florida Keys National Marine Sanctuary. The NEEMO 21 crew will perform research both inside and outside the habitat during a 16-day simulated space mission. During simulated spacewalks carried out underwater, they will evaluate tools and mission operation techniques that could be used in future space missions, including journeys to Mars. An artist has created series of wacky images turning everyday items into hilarious and all but impossible to use objects. Giuseppe Colarusso, 49, fashioned the unique work to make people question the functionality of the likes of cutlery, garden tools and office equipment. The set of playful pictures, entitled “Improbabilita”, makes some items impossible to use, others improbable and some given a completely new function altogether. From a dice with no spots, to a ping pong paddle with a hole in it, the items have all been given a quirky twist. Photo: Cuttlery with rope handles. (Photo by Giuseppe Colarusso/Caters News)

Glass Art By Kiva Ford

Glass artist Kiva Ford draws from his vast experience in scientific glassblowing to create perfect miniatures of wine glasses, beakers, and ribbon-striped vases, some scarcely an inch tall. A member of the American Scientific Glassblowers Society, Kiva creates instruments for scientists who require one-of-a-kind designs for various experiments. The same techniques and tools used for scientific equipment also apply to his artistic practice including the miniature works you see here, as well as larger sculptures, and ornate drinkware.
